Step-by-Step: How I Make One Pot Bacon Cheeseburger Rice Recipe

Step 1: Crisp the Bacon First

Start by cooking the chopped bacon in a large pot over medium heat until it’s nice and crispy. This not only gives you that irresistible bacon crunch but also renders flavorful grease—just leave about a teaspoon in the pan for cooking the beef later. Pro tip: don’t discard the bacon fat; it adds an amazing depth to the dish.

Step 2: Brown the Beef with Onion and Garlic

Next, add ground beef, diced onion, and minced garlic to the pot with the bacon grease. Cook it all together until the beef is browned and the onions are softened. Drain excess grease carefully so your dish isn’t too oily but still retains flavor. This step builds the meaty base for the recipe.

Step 3: Layer in the Flavor Boosters

Stir in your burger seasoning and Worcestershire sauce, letting those ingredients mingle for a minute or two. Then mix in tomato paste, cooking a little longer to deepen the tomato flavor. Follow that up with dill pickle relish, mustard, and tomato sauce—these ingredients are what make this rice taste like a cheeseburger in the best way possible.

Step 4: Cook the Rice in One Pot

Add uncooked rice and beef broth, stir everything together, and bring to a boil. Once boiling, reduce heat to low and cover the pot, letting it simmer for about 18 to 20 minutes until the rice is tender and has soaked up all that savory liquid. Resist the urge to lift the lid too soon—patience here means perfectly cooked rice!

Step 5: Melt the Cheese and Finish Strong

Remove the pot from heat and stir in half the shredded cheese along with the crispy bacon you set aside. Sprinkle the remaining cheese on top, cover again, and let it sit for 3 to 5 minutes. This resting time lets the cheese melt into gooey perfection, creating that classic cheeseburger warmth you crave.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

After we’ve eaten, I store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ge—and it keeps well for up to 4 days. When reheating, I add a splash of broth to bring back moisture and prevent the rice from drying out, stirring it gently over low heat or in the microwave.

Freezing

If I’m making this ahead for busy weeks, I freeze portions in freezer-safe containers or bags for up to 2 months. Just be sure to add a little broth or water when reheating to keep the texture pleasant and avoid any dryness.

Reheating

Reheating is best done gently on the stovetop with a splash of broth or in the microwave covered to trap steam. Stirring occasionally helps the cheese melt evenly again and brings the dish back to its original creamy goodness.

FAQs

  1. Can I use a different type of rice for this recipe?

    Absolutely! While I prefer Jasmine rice for its fragrance and texture, you can use basmati or any long-grain white rice. Just keep in mind cooking times may vary slightly, so check the rice toward the end to ensure it’s tender.

  2. Is it possible to make this vegetarian?

    Yes! Swap the ground beef and bacon for plant-based meat alternatives or extra vegetables like mushrooms and bell peppers. Use vegetable broth instead of beef broth, and choose your favorite cheese or a vegan cheese substitute.

  3. How spicy is this dish by default?

    By default, this One Pot Bacon Cheeseburger Rice Recipe isn’t spicy—it’s all about savory and tangy flavors. If you like heat, I recommend adding jalapeños or a dash of hot sauce to suit your taste.

  4. Can I prepare this recipe in advance?

    Definitely! It stores well in the fridge for several days and freezes beautifully too. This makes it a great option for meal prep or quick dinners after a busy day.

One Pot Bacon Cheeseburger Rice Recipe

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star 4.4 from 9 reviews
  • Author: Amanda
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Category: Main Course
  • Method: Stovetop
  • Cuisine: American

Description

A comforting and flavorful one pot bacon cheeseburger rice recipe combining crispy bacon, seasoned ground beef, and melted sharp cheddar cheese with tender jasmine rice simmered in beef broth and tomato sauce for an easy and hearty meal.


Ingredients

Units Scale

Meat and Seasonings

  • 6-8 slices bacon, chopped
  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1 tbsp Kinder’s Caramelized Onion Burger Seasoning or favorite burger seasoning
  • 2 tsps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tbsp tomato paste
  • 1 tbsp dill pickle relish
  • 1 tsp yellow or Dijon mustard

Vegetables and Aromatics

  • 1 small onion, diced
  • 3-4 garlic cloves, minced

Liquids and Staples

  • 8 oz can tomato sauce
  • 1 cup uncooked long grain white rice (Jasmine rice used)
  • 2 1/4 cups beef broth

Cheese

  • 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ese (or preferred cheese flavor)

Instructions

  1. Cook Bacon: Cook chopped bacon in a large pot over medium heat until crispy, about 5-7 minutes. Remove bacon with a slotted spoon and transfer to a paper towel-lined plate; set aside.
  2. Brown Meat and Aromatics: Leave about 1 teaspoon of bacon grease in the pot. Add ground beef, diced onion, and minced garlic. Cook over medium-high heat until beef is browned and onions are softened, about 6-8 minutes. Drain excess grease carefully.
  3. Season Meat: Stir in garlic, caramelized onion burger seasoning, and Worcestershire sauce. Cook for 1-2 minutes to blend flavors.
  4. Add Tomato Paste: Mix in tomato paste and cook for another 1-2 minutes, stirring frequently to deepen the flavor.
  5. Incorporate Pickle and Mustard: Stir in dill pickle relish, mustard, and tomato sauce until well combined.
  6. Add Rice and Broth: Pour in uncooked rice and beef broth. Stir everything together, bring to a boil over high heat.
  7. Simmer Rice: Reduce heat to low, cover the pot, and let simmer for 20 minutes or until rice is tender and liquid is absorbed.
  8. Mix in Cheese and Bacon: Remove pot from heat. Stir in 1 cup of shredded cheese and the reserved cooked bacon until melted and well incorporated.
  9. Top with Cheese and Melt: Sprinkle the remaining 1 cup of cheese over the top. Cover and let sit for 3-5 minutes until cheese is melted and gooey.
  10. Serve: Serve the bacon cheeseburger rice hot and enjoy your hearty one pot meal.

Notes

  • Add jalapeños or hot sauce if you want a spicy kick.
  • Swap ground beef with ground turkey or chicken for a leaner version.
  • Incorporate extra vegetables like mushrooms or bell peppers for more flavor and nutrition.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
  • Freeze leftovers in portions for up to 2 months; reheat with a splash of broth or water to restore moisture.
